How To Prepare Butter BBQ Sauce?
Recipe Overview
Prep Time: 5 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 15 minutes
Course: Sauce / Condiment
Difficulty: Easy
Cuisine: American
Yield: About 1 cup
Equipment Needed
- Medium saucepan
- Wooden spoon or silicone spatula
- Jar or container for storing
- Measuring cups & spoons
Ingredients
- ½ cup (1 stick) unsalted butter
- ½ cup ketchup
- 1 tsp salt
- ⅛ tsp freshly ground black pepper
- ½ cup finely diced onion
- ¼ cup light brown sugar (packed)
- 1½ tsp chili powder
- Dash of Tabasco (optional, for heat)
- 3 Tbsp Worcestershire sauce
Instructions
1. In your sa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add onion and cook until tender and translucent, about 3–4 minutes. Stir in ketchup,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, chili powder, Tabasco, salt, and pepper. Mix thoroughly.
2. Bring the sauce to a gentle simmer. Cook for about 5–6 minutes, stirring frequently, until it thickens and becomes glossy. Taste the sauce and adjust salt or spice levels. If you want more heat, add a touch more chili powder or Tabasco.

Hot Tips Hot Tips
➤ Use unsalted butter to control the salt level in your sauce more precisely.
➤ Adjust the sweetness by tasting and adding brown sugar gradually to avoid overpowering the sauce.
➤ Let the sauce simmer gently to develop deeper flavors without burning the butter.
➤ Freshly ground black pepper adds a subtle kick that enhances the overall taste.

Proper Storage Butter BBQ Sauce
Store Butter BBQ Sauce in an airtight container or glass jar to keep it fresh. Refrigeration slows down spoilage and helps maintain its rich flavor and texture.
Before using, gently reheat the sauce on low heat to restore its smooth consistency. Avoid overheating, which can cause the butter to separate.
Properly stored, the sauce stays good for up to two weeks. Always check for any changes in smell or appearance before use to ensure freshness and safety.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is Butter BBQ Sauce Spicy?
It has a mild kick depending on how much chili powder or hot sauce is added, but it’s generally balanced and not overly spicy.
Can I Freeze Butter BBQ Sauce?
Freezing is possible but may affect the texture slightly. Thaw gently and stir well before using.
Can I Use Salted Butter Instead Of Unsalted?
Yes, but reduce added salt in the recipe to avoid making the sauce too salty.
